Ronan Dunne, Executive Vice President & Group CEO of Verizon Consumer
Ronan Dunne
Ronan is EVP & Group CEO of Verizon Consumer. He leads the teams responsible for providing wireline voice, data and TV products and services and wireless connected experiences to more than 100 million consumers every day. In addition, his teams are helping to build the first 5G technology network that will redefine how customers live, work and play. Prior to this, Ronan was executive vice president and president of Verizon Wireless, responsible for all aspects of Wireless’ strategy, product development, marketing, operations, customer care and digital operations. He led the teams that provide products and communications services for consumer, business and government customers on the nation’s largest and most reliable network. Before coming to Verizon, Ronan was chief executive officer of Telefónica UK (O2). While leading O2 UK, the largest wireless operator in the United Kingdom, he significantly improved market leadership across brand, customer satisfaction and loyalty. Ronan was previously O2’s chief financial officer in the UK, and prior to that, served as head of finance and deputy to the group chief financial officer of O2. Prior to joining O2 in 2001, Ronan held senior positions in banking with Banque Nationale de Paris and in the corporate sector with Exel plc. and Waste Management International plc. He is a fellow and former council member of the Chartered Accountants Ireland (CAI) and a fellow of the Association of Corporate Treasurers (ACT). Ronan is a Counsellor for the One Young World charity that brings together young leaders from around the world and empowers them to make lasting connections to create positive change. Born and raised in Dublin, Ireland, Ronan and his wife Elaine now reside in New Jersey, USA. He is an avid sports fan and enjoys soccer, rugby, field hockey and traveling with his family. Shaun Sharkey, Equity Investment Manager, Crowdcube
Shaun Sharkey operates in the Investment Team at Crowdcube. His role is to source the U.K's hottest startups for the Crowdcube platform. He assists those startups to raise investment from the crowd, which enables them to unlock the power of community-driven growth. This was an entertaining discussion about Startups, Scale-ups and how Shaun helps Founders, Co-Founders to make their dreams come true through crowd funding. This phenomenon was pioneered by Crowdcube who've helped organisations such as Monzo, Brewdog, Revolut, Perkbox and more recently what3words and Moneybox plus many other's to get support and access to capital to scale their idea. Since this episode was recorded a huge announcement that Crowdcube and Seedrs, have agreed to merge, in a move that will accelerate their shared plan to create the world’s largest private equity marketplace and further democratise investment.
